TTN Electric versus Senza Solar

Compare Solar Panel Manufacturers: TTN Electric vs Senza Solar

EnergyPal TTN Electric  Solar Panels Manufacturer

Website:

http://www.ttnsolar.com

Country:

China

Address:

No. 28, Chuangda Road, Lucheng Light Industrial Zone, Wenzhou, Zhejiang

EnergyPal Senza Solar Solar Panels Manufacturer

Website:

http://www.senzasolar.com

Country:

India

Address:

Plot No 106, Sector 16, HSIIDC Industrial Estate, Bahadurgarh, 124507, Haryana

Compare TTN Electric TTN-M150W-36 with Senza Solar Solar Panels

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-10

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-100

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-105

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-150

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-160

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-20

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-200

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-210

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-250

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-255

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-260

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-265

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-270

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-275

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-280

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-305

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-310

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-315

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-320

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-325

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-330

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-335

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-340

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-40

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-50

Compare TTN Electric TTN-M150W-36 & Senza Solar SNS-75